Indiana courts use a portal E-filing model that allows the public to choose from several providers. There are also links to legal forms, civil legal aid programs, and mediation services, and efiling: [link] The Louisianacourts are served by the Louisiana Bar Foundation LouisianaLawHelp.org website that in turn addresses many topics.
Southeast Louisiana Legal Services Corporation’s $32,359 grant will allow it to work with an expert to assess and improve the security of its technology. The hub will act as a secure mobile platform for pro bono attorneys to respond to client communications and review and provide one-on-one guidance on courtforms.
